I’m a local Indianapolis investor. Also, a Indianapolis PM, but happy to help just as a fellow investor. Shoot me a PM. I think it’s smart to go B class. That’s what I own personally. D class looks great on paper but tough to actually pencil out unless you do everything your self for basically free.
